package org.sonar.plugins.pmd;
import net.sourceforge.pmd.RuleViolation;
import org.sonar.api.batch.fs.InputFile;
import org.sonar.api.batch.fs.TextPointer;
import org.sonar.api.batch.fs.TextRange;
/**
* Calculates a {@link org.sonar.api.batch.fs.TextRange} for a given {@link net.sourceforge.pmd.RuleViolation}.
*/
class TextRangeCalculator {
private TextRangeCalculator() {
}
static TextRange calculate(RuleViolation pmdViolation, InputFile inputFile) {
final int startLine = calculateBeginLine(pmdViolation);
final int endLine = calculateEndLine(pmdViolation);
// PMD counts TABs differently, so we can not use RuleViolation#getBeginColumn and RuleViolation#getEndColumn
// Therefore, we select complete lines.
final TextPointer startPointer = inputFile.selectLine(startLine).start();
final TextPointer endPointer = inputFile.selectLine(endLine).end();
return inputFile.newRange(startPointer, endPointer);
}
/**
* Calculates the endLIne of a violation report.
*
* @param pmdViolation The violation for which the endLine should be calculated.
* @return The endLine is assumed to be the line with the biggest number.
*/
private static int calculateEndLine(RuleViolation pmdViolation) {
return Math.max(pmdViolation.getBeginLine(), pmdViolation.getEndLine());
}
/**
* Calculates the beginLine of a violation report.
*
* @param pmdViolation The violation for which the beginLine should be calculated.
* @return The beginLine is assumed to be the line with the smallest number. However, if the smallest number is
* out-of-range (non-positive), it takes the other number.
*/
private static int calculateBeginLine(RuleViolation pmdViolation) {
int minLine = Math.min(pmdViolation.getBeginLine(), pmdViolation.getEndLine());
return minLine > 0 ? minLine : calculateEndLine(pmdViolation);
}
}
